Step 1
Heat the oil in a frypan. Cook the minced beef and onion until the beef is browned and the onion is soft, remove from the heat.
Step 2
Stir in the salt, oregano, garlic powder and pepper.
Step 3
In a bowl, beat the eggs, milk and mayonnaise together, then stir into the meat mixture. Fold in the cheeses.
Step 4
Line a lightly greased 23cm pie plate with the sheet of puff pastry. Pour in the mince mixture.
Step 5
Bake uncovered at 190C for 40-45 minutes, or until it is golden and puffed in the centre.
Step 6
Rest for 5 minutes before cutting.
